Company Description

Genomics England partners with the NHS to provide whole genome sequencing diagnostics. We also equip researchers to find the causes of disease and develop new treatments – with patients and participants at the heart of it all.

Our mission is to continue refining, scaling, and evolving our ability to enable others to deliver genomic healthcare and conduct genomic research.

We are accelerating our impact and working with patients, doctors, scientists, government and industry to improve genomic testing, and help researchers access the health data and technology they need to make new medical discoveries and create more effective, targeted medicines for everybody.

Job Description

Here at Genomics England, we are seeking a highly skilled and experienced Identity and Access Management (IAM) Solution Architect, with specialist knowledge of Okta and a broad knowledge of other related tools such as AWS Identify Centre, NHS CIS2, Azure AD etc. 

The successful candidate will be responsible for designing, implementing, and managing IAM solutions that leverage Okta's capabilities to ensure secure and efficient access to our systems and applications across our cloud and on-premise estate. 

You will be a key member of our team working with product managers, engineers and suppliers to determine how our IAM solution evolves as part of GEL’s Cloud Centre of Excellence (CCoE). This Solutions Architect role sits within the Scalable Tech Service and underpins our Healthcare and Research services as well as our operational business functions. Your previous roles will include having designed and implemented large-scale identity and access management solutions with multiple complex cohorts.

Essential Skills and Experience: 

  • Strong understanding of IAM principles, standards, and best practices. 

  • Proven experience as an IAM Solution Architect, with a strong focus on Okta. 

  • Architecture and design of a hub-and-spoke identity model using Okta as the central Identity Provider (IdP), with deep integration into AWS Identity and Active Directory environments. 

  • Deep knowledge of Okta, primarily as an IdP, but also Okta Zero Trust principles, sign-on policies, workflows.  

  • Experience of a wide range of related IAM tools/technologies e.g. AWS Identity Centre, NHS CIS2, SCIM provisioning, SAML, OIDC, OAuth2, Kerberos, LDAP/LDAPS, RADIUS/TACACS+ 

  • Ability to design and deliver an enterprise-grade IAM service using Okta, aligned with internal standards and roadmaps. 

  • Strong understanding of AD forest/domain design, group policy objects (GPOs), delegation models, and hybrid identity synchronisation with cloud IdPs. 

  • Deep understanding of identity governance, including:  

  • Lifecycle management / JML (Joiner-Mover-Leaver)  

  • Access reviews and certification  

  • Federation and posture-aware access  

  • Zero Trust principles and adaptive authentication models.

What We Do

Genomics England works with the NHS to bring forward the use of genomic healthcare and research in Britain to help people live longer, healthier lives.

Genomics is a ground-breaking area of medicine that uses our unique genetic code to help diagnose, treat and prevent illnesses. Thanks to advanced technology, scientists can now compare many people’s genetic code to make new discoveries that continually improve genomic healthcare.

In 2013, Genomics England and the NHS launched the 100,000 Genomes Project, demonstrating how genomics insights can help doctors across the NHS, and building a foundation for the future by assembling a unique dataset. Genomics England is now supporting the NHS to deliver genomic testing for patients as part of routine healthcare, and providing the health data and technology that researchers need to make new discoveries and create more effective, targeted medicines.

We work with thousands of people – patients, doctors and scientists – to increase our collective knowledge and enable faster and deeper genomic research, to bring genomic healthcare to all who need it.
